Frequently Asked Questions about Ann Arbor
How much are Studio apartments in Ann Arbor?
There are currently 349 Studio Apartments in Ann Arbor with rent ranges from $1,020 to $3,383 with an average price of $1,717.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Ann Arbor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Ann Arbor ranges from $800 to $4,043 with an average monthly rent of $1,706.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Ann Arbor c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Ann Arbor range from $985 to $4,349.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,205.
How expensive are Ann Arbor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 147 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Ann Arbor on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,272 to $4,575 - averaging $2,655 for the location.
